Mailinglisten-Archive |
Was ist denn mit dem Komma vor dem where? Wenn du das wegläßt? -----Ursprüngliche Nachricht----- Von: php-admin_(at)_php-center.de [mailto:php-admin_(at)_php-center.de]Im Auftrag von Jan-Henrik Kern Gesendet: Dienstag, 14. November 2000 00:42 An: php_(at)_solix. wiso. Uni-Koeln. DE Betreff: [php] update script läuft nicht.. Hallo Liste, ich hab hier mal ein Script gebastelt, welches Daten aus einem HTML-Form Übernimmt und daraufhin die Datenbank updaten soll. das macht er aber nicht, sondern gibt folgenden fehler aus: You have an error in your SQL syntax near 'where id=2' at line 1 wobei id=2 den aktuellen datensatz bezeichnet. hab ich irgendwo ein " übersehen? ich konnte leider nix finden. vielleicht werft ihr ja mal einen Blick drauf! Gruß, Jan-Henrik <?php mysql_connect('xxx','xxx','xxx'); if ($id==0) { echo "Hinzugefügt"; $result = mysql_db_query("db8782","insert into boerse (Position, Unternehmen, Branche, Umsatz, Standort, Schwerpunkte, Dotierung, Sonstiges, Ausbildung, Fahigkeiten, alters, Sonstige, Berater) Values (\"$Position\", \"$Unternehmen\", \"$Branche\", \"$Umsatz\", \"$Standort\", \"$Schwerpunkte\", \"$Dotierung\", \"$Sonstiges\", \"$Ausbildung\", \"$Fahigkeiten\", \"$alters\", \"$Sonstige\", \"$Berater\" )"); } else { echo $id," wurde geupdated"; $result = mysql_db_query("db8782","update boerse set Position=\"".$Position."\",Unternehmen=\"".$Unternehmen."\",Branche=\"".$Bra nche."\",Umsatz=\"".$Umsatz."\",Standort=\"".$Standort."\",Schwerpunkte=\"". $Schwerpunkte."\",Dotierung=\"".$Dotierung."\",Sonstiges=\"".$Sonstiges."\", Ausbildung=\"".$Ausbildung."\",Fahigkeiten=\"".$Fahigkeiten."\",alters=\"".$ alters."\",Sonstige=\"".$Sonstige."\",Berater=\"".$Berater."\", where id=$id"); } echo mysql_error(); ?> ======== Jan-Henrik Kern eMail: jhk_(at)_my-server.org URL: www.kerny.org ICQ UIN: 9003569 -- ** Durchgehend geöffnet: http://www.php-center.de ** Die PHP-Liste: mailto:php_(at)_php-center.de http://infosoc.uni-koeln.de/mailman/listinfo/php
php::bar PHP Wiki - Listenarchive